About this course
The Yacht Master 100GT (Power) course is a professional skipper qualification designed for those who want to command power driven yachts up to 100 gross tons for commercial or private use. This program blends advanced navigation, seamanship, safety management, and leadership, preparing students to take full responsibility for vessel, crew, and passengers in international waters. Whether your goal is to captain a luxury charter yacht, manage private vessels, or progress toward a 200GT licence, this certificate gives you the skills and credibility to work professionally at sea.
Before you start
Entry requirements
- Minimum age: 18 years old
- Hold a Yacht Skipper (Power) or Boat Master certificate (or equivalent experience)
- Logged sea time: typically 30 to 50 days or 1,500 nautical miles at sea, including 30 hours as night watch leader (with evidence in logbook or letter of sea service)
- STCW Basic Safety Training (mandatory for commercial endorsement)
- Medical fitness certificate (ENG1 or equivalent recommended)
- Good English proficiency (for navigation, exams, and communication)
- Valid ID or passport
What you will cover
Course program
Advanced Navigation and Passage Planning
- Chart work, tides, currents, and pilotage
- GPS, radar, and electronic chart systems
- Weather forecasting and route planning
Yacht Handling and Seamanship
- Docking, anchoring, and berthing larger yachts
- Close quarters manoeuvring in challenging conditions
- Handling under power in open and confined waters
Safety and Emergency Management
- Fire, flooding, and onboard emergencies
- Man overboard drills and recovery with large vessels
- Risk assessment and safety planning
Crew Leadership and Professional Practice
- Watch keeping organisation and bridge management
- Crew delegation and passenger safety
- Logbook, documentation, and operational procedures
Regulations and Communication
- International COLREGS for power vessels
- Radio communication (VHF/DSC) and distress protocols
- Legal responsibilities of the captain
Assessment
- Written exam
- Practical exam
